#include <ctime>
#include <iostream>
#include <fstream>
#include <string>
#include <vector>
#include "../headers/modsecurity/anchored_variable.h"
#include "modsecurity/modsecurity.h"
#include "modsecurity/transaction.h"
#include "src/utils/regex.h"
namespace modsecurity {
AnchoredVariable::AnchoredVariable(Transaction *t,
std::string name)
: m_transaction(t),
m_offset(0),
m_name(""),
m_value(""),
m_var(NULL) {
m_name.append(name);
m_var = new VariableValue(&m_name);
}
AnchoredVariable::~AnchoredVariable() {
if (m_var) {
delete (m_var);
m_var = NULL;
}
}
void AnchoredVariable::unset() {
m_value.clear();
}
void AnchoredVariable::set(const std::string &a, size_t offset,
size_t offsetLen) {
std::unique_ptr<VariableOrigin> origin(new VariableOrigin());
m_offset = offset;
m_value.assign(a.c_str(), a.size());
origin->m_offset = offset;
origin->m_length = offsetLen;
m_var->addOrigin(std::move(origin));
}
void AnchoredVariable::set(const std::string &a, size_t offset) {
std::unique_ptr<VariableOrigin> origin(new VariableOrigin());
m_offset = offset;
m_value.assign(a.c_str(), a.size());
origin->m_offset = offset;
origin->m_length = m_value.size();
m_var->addOrigin(std::move(origin));
}
void AnchoredVariable::append(const std::string &a, size_t offset,
bool spaceSeparator) {
std::unique_ptr<VariableOrigin> origin(
new VariableOrigin());
if (spaceSeparator && !m_value.empty()) {
m_value.append(" " + a);
} else {
m_value.append(a);
}
m_offset = offset;
origin->m_offset = offset;
origin->m_length = a.size();
m_var->addOrigin(std::move(origin));
}
void AnchoredVariable::append(const std::string &a, size_t offset,
bool spaceSeparator, int size) {
std::unique_ptr<VariableOrigin> origin(
new VariableOrigin());
if (spaceSeparator && !m_value.empty()) {
m_value.append(" " + a);
} else {
m_value.append(a);
}
m_offset = offset;
origin->m_offset = offset;
origin->m_length = size;
m_var->addOrigin(std::move(origin));
}
void AnchoredVariable::evaluate(std::vector<const VariableValue *> *l) {
if (m_name.empty()) {
return;
}
m_var->setValue(m_value);
VariableValue *m_var2 = new VariableValue(m_var);
l->push_back(m_var2);
}
std::string * AnchoredVariable::evaluate() {
return &m_value;
}
std::unique_ptr<std::string> AnchoredVariable::resolveFirst() {
if (m_value.empty()) {
return nullptr;
}
std::unique_ptr<std::string> a(new std::string());
a->append(m_value);
return a;
}
} // namespace modsecurity
